Cleiton Abrão (born 8 September 1989) is a Brazilian middle-distance runner competing primarily in the 800 metres.[2] He represented his country at the 2015 World Championships in Beijing without advancing from the first round.
His personal best in the event is 1:45.59 set in São Paulo in 2014.
